India is the world's second-largest producer of carpets, after China. India is the top producer and exporter of handmade carpets and floor coverings in terms of value and volume. Labor-intensive The carpet industry is highly labor-intensive, employing over 2 million workers and artisans, especially women.

India is the world's largest producer of cotton, with 9 million hectares of cotton acreage. In 2016-17, India produced 345 lakh bales of cotton, and is the second largest exporter of cotton after China.
